What is RTP and Why It Matters
Return to Player, or RTP, is one of the most important metrics in online gambling. It represents the percentage of all wagered money that a slot machine returns to players over time. For example, a slot with a 96% RTP will theoretically return $96 for every $100 wagered, with the remaining 4% going to the casino.

RTP vs. Volatility
Don’t confuse RTP with volatility. While RTP measures long-term returns, volatility indicates how frequently wins occur. A high-RTP slot with low volatility offers regular small wins, while high-volatility games provide larger but less frequent payouts.
